Maui Jim strengthens collection of sunglasses for people who love spending time on the water
Last Update: Sunday, September 22, 2013 : 13:00 (+4GMT)
Hours of squinting from the glare and UV rays from the sun can make it a long day on the water, whether you're fishing or floating. However, Maui Jim has an entire collection of sunglasses with patented polarized lens technology that eliminates glare and UV rays while making what you see more brilliant and colorful. Today, the company is adding a new style – Ikaika (Style #281, AED 1,152) – to its ON THE WATER Collection of 24 sunglasses that have special features and benefits for anyone who spends time on the oceans, lakes, rivers or streams.
Ikaika, like each of the styles in the ON THE WATER Collection, uses technologies that are designed to work with different face sizes and shapes to shield eyes when enjoying time on the water. Ikaika is perfect for larger faces with bigger lenses; wider temples that offer a snug fit; anti-corrosive, spring hinge hardware; oleophobic lens coatings to repel water and grease; and scratch-resistant properties. Ikaika is a saltwater friendly style with a contoured, aerodynamic shape has been updated with matte finishes and comes in two high-grade nylon frame colors: Matte Black Rubber or Matte Tortoise. Both options have a saddle-style fixed nose bridge with anti-slip embedded rubber nose pads for comfort and stability.
Unique to all Maui Jim sunglasses is patented PolarizedPlus2® lens technology that protects eyes from the sun's rays on both sides of each lens. This technology reduces 99.9 percent of harmful glare from any flat, smooth, or shiny surface. This technology increases definition and depth perception which makes it possible to see below the surface of water, an invaluable feature for boaters and anglers. Additionally, Maui Jim sunglasses cut 100 percent of UVA and UVB rays. Each style in the ON THE WATER Collection has unique, bi-gradient mirror technology that adds protection from light through the top and bottom of each lens – basically, Maui Jim sunglasses squint for you to reduce eye fatigue.
Ikaika has Maui Jim's SuperThin (ST) Glass lenses that are 20 percent thinner and lighter than conventional glass lenses. The lenses are digitally engineered to produce ultra-clear views without distortion. At Maui Jim, lens color is not merely a style feature. It is a functional feature. Maui Jim is the only company whose lenses have up to nine layers of advanced protection including color-enhancing components that produce noticeably truer, more vivid colors. Ikaika comes in two distortion-free lens colors to maximize performance in various light conditions. Neutral Grey lenses offer the maximum level of light reduction without color distortion for bright, sunny days. HCL® Bronze lenses have a versatile, warm brown tint suitable for any activity and designed to improve vision in variable light conditions.
Ikaika is available with MauiPassport® prescription lenses in powers from +3.00 to -4.50. This style has an eye size of 64 mm; bridge size of 18 mm; and temple length of 130 mm, as well as an 8-base curvature.
